Meet Canisha Harris of LCPB Financial Services

Today we’d like to introduce you to Canisha Harris.

Hi Canisha, we’d love for you to start by introducing yourself
I am a wife, mother, Christ believer, friend, sister, and business owner. Life has given me many titles and I do my best to make sure I find balance. I was born and raised in Little Rock, AR and recently moved to Memphis, TN. I always knew I wanted to work for myself. I just did not know what I wanted to do exactly. Around 2017, I started to strengthen my relationship with God. I heard the scripture Jeremiah 29:11 for the first time and started to believe that God created me with a purpose. If I wanted to figure out what that purpose was, I would have to ask the source.

I remember being at work one day and asking God to reveal to me what my purpose was. Then the thought of helping people with their finances became clear to me. At this time, I had accounts payable experience. I did not have any type of investing or advising experience.

From there, I started taking financial planning courses at a local university. I loved what I was learning. I then went on to work for a bank as a financial consultant. It was during that time that it became even more apparent that people needed financial literacy.

Since that time, God has given me ideas and helped me to structure LCPB.

Alright, so let’s dig a little deeper into the story – has it been an easy path overall, and if not, what were the challenges you’ve had to overcome?
It has not been a smooth road at all. Working for yourself is not easy. With LCPB, I want to help youth and young adults learn about finances before they make big mistakes. In reality, my target clients do not have the funds to pay me. I have had to restructure things a few times, but I am finally on a path that seems to be working for everyone involved.

Appreciate you sharing that. What should we know about LCPB Financial Services LLC?
At LCPB Financial Services LLC, we encourage Living freely, Creating legacies, Prospering together, and Building wealth. We provide the knowledge and resources needed in order to eliminate financial stress. I believe that in order to do better regarding your finances, you must first change your mindset. Otherwise, everything that I teach will not resonate with you. I teach youth and young adults about the importance of using their money as a tool.

Money should be viewed more like a seed and should not just be used for consumption. I am known for my ability to make financial literacy topics easy to understand and relatable to those who do not have a strong financial understanding. My personality sets me apart from others. Learning about finances can be boring at times. I make the topic fun because that is the best way to learn new information. I am most proud of the responses I receive after a session or one on one. Knowing that the audience learned something that they never knew before is the best feeling I have ever experienced while working. I want readers to know that I am here and available.

What quality or characteristic do you feel is most important to your success?
Being authentic. Not putting up a false perception of knowing everything there is to know about finances, but still being about to help people make better choices.
